【问题标题】:Add text below "Lost your password?" field在“忘记密码?”下方添加文字场地
【发布时间】:2019-11-28 12:39:10
【问题描述】:

总体而言,我对 WooCommerce 和 WordPress 有点陌生。 因此,我试图在我的帐户 WooCommerce 登录表单的“丢失密码”字段下方添加一些文本,但即使我在 login-form.php 的忘记密码部分下方添加了p anchor,我也没有成功文件,但实际上页面上没有任何变化。我应该做些什么? 基本上,我想做的是添加一个带有指向另一个页面的链接的文本行。我想知道是否有人可以告诉我应该在哪个文件中添加我的代码行以及是否可以这样做。

The picture shows what I'm talking about

谢谢。

【问题讨论】:

    标签: wordpress woocommerce


    【解决方案1】:

    您可以使用“login_footer”挂钩在“丢失密码”字段下方添加文本。 您可以在 wordpress 根目录的 wp-login.php 中找到更多钩子,并根据您的要求添加文本。

    在子主题functions.php中的某处添加这样的代码:

    add_action('login_footer', 'add_text_forgot_pass');
    function add_text_forgot_pass(){
        echo "Extra TEXT";
    }
    

    如果您还有其他问题,请告诉我们。谢谢。

    【讨论】:

    • 您好,感谢您的回答。但是,login_footer 是什么意思?我说的是在我的帐户字段的 woocommerce 登录页面中添加文本。
    • 我看到你在上面分享的截图。您可以使用“login_footer”挂钩在屏幕截图中指向的位置添加文本。只需在functions.php中粘贴代码,文本就会显示出来。
    【解决方案2】:

    您可以使用下面的钩子在 WooCommerce 我的帐户页面登录表单后添加任何内容。将此代码添加到活动主题的 function.php 文件中。

    add_action('woocommerce_after_customer_login_form', 'add_text_after_login');
    
    function add_text_after_login() {
        echo "Custom Content";
    }
    

    woocommerce_after_customer_login_form & woocommerce_before_customer_login_form 这两个钩子用于在登录表单之后或之前添加内容。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2013-08-03
      • 2011-12-19
      • 1970-01-01
      • 2020-10-19
      • 2012-07-25
      • 1970-01-01
      • 1970-01-01
      • 2012-12-20
      相关资源
      最近更新 更多